Lawyer wellness and well-being have been hot topics in the legal community for a while. Lawyer wellness isn’t necessarily limited to young lawyers; it encompasses lawyers of all ages, backgrounds and years of practice. When lawyers maintain a healthy lifestyle, it’s easier for them to advocate zealously for their clients. The components of a healthy lifestyle can range from regular exercise and a healthy diet to playing with your pet and reading a book for fun. Time away from law practice is important. It gives us lawyers the mental break we need to do our job effectively when we do return to work.
